public class ProjectGetInfoController
extends java.lang.Object
implements java.io.Serializable
コンストラクタと説明 |
---|
ProjectGetInfoController()
ProjectGetInfoControllerのコンストラクタを生成します。
|
ProjectGetInfoController(SapClient sapClient)
ProjectGetInfoControllerのコンストラクタを生成します。
|
修飾子とタイプ | メソッドと説明 |
---|---|
void |
executeBapi()
ProjectGetInfoのexecuteBapi()を呼び出しWBSの詳細を取得します。
|
java.util.List<ExpActivity> |
getExpActivityList()
活動に関する詳細情報を取得します。
|
java.util.List<ExpMessage> |
getExpMessageList()
詳細情報を読み込みエラーを取得します。
|
java.util.List<ExpWbsElement> |
getExpWbsElementList()
WBS 要素についての詳細情報を取得します。
|
java.util.List<ExpWbsHierarchie> |
getExpWbsHierarchieList()
WBS 階層についての情報を取得します。
|
java.util.List<ExpWbsMilestone> |
getExpWbsMilestoneList()
WBS マイルストーンに関する詳細情報を取得します。
|
java.util.List<ImpWbsElement> |
getImpWbsElementList()
詳細情報を必要とする WBS 要素を取得します。
|
java.lang.String |
getProjectDefinition()
プロジェクト定義を識別するキーを取得します。
|
ProjectDefinition |
getProjectDefinitionInfo()
プロジェクトについての詳細情報を取得します。
|
java.lang.String |
getWithActivities()
従属活動を取得します。
|
java.lang.String |
getWithMilestones()
従属 WBS マイルストーンを取得します。
|
java.lang.String |
getWithSubtree()
サブプロジェクトを取得します。
|
void |
setExpActivityList(java.util.List<ExpActivity> expActivityList)
活動に関する詳細情報を設定します。
|
void |
setExpMessageList(java.util.List<ExpMessage> expMessageList)
詳細情報を読み込みエラーを設定します。
|
void |
setExpWbsElementList(java.util.List<ExpWbsElement> expWbsElementList)
WBS 要素についての詳細情報を設定します。
|
void |
setExpWbsHierarchieList(java.util.List<ExpWbsHierarchie> expWbsHierarchieList)
WBS 階層についての情報を設定します。
|
void |
setExpWbsMilestoneList(java.util.List<ExpWbsMilestone> expWbsMilestoneList)
WBS マイルストーンに関する詳細情報を設定します。
|
void |
setImpWbsElementList(java.util.List<ImpWbsElement> impWbsElementList)
詳細情報を必要とする WBS 要素を設定します。
|
void |
setProjectDefinition(ProjectDefinition projectDefinition)
プロジェクトについての詳細情報を設定します。
|
void |
setProjectDefinition(java.lang.String strProjectDefinition)
プロジェクト定義を識別するキーを設定します。
|
void |
setTblParam(java.lang.String paramTable,
java.lang.String paramName,
java.lang.String value,
int index)
テーブル型の項目に値をセットします。
|
void |
setWithActivities(java.lang.String strWithActivities)
従属活動を設定します。
|
void |
setWithMilestones(java.lang.String strWithMilestones)
従属 WBS マイルストーンを設定します。
|
void |
setWithSubtree(java.lang.String strWithSubtree)
サブプロジェクトを設定します。
|
public ProjectGetInfoController()
public ProjectGetInfoController(SapClient sapClient)
sapClient
- SapClient SAPへの接続情報が格納されたオブジェクトpublic void executeBapi() throws SAPAuthAppException, SAPAuthSystemException, SAPGeneralAppException, SAPGeneralSystemException, SAPFinancialAppException, SAPFinancialSystemException
SAPAuthAppException
- 認証系アプリケーション例外SAPAuthSystemException
- 認証系システム例外SAPGeneralAppException
- 汎用アプリケーション例外SAPGeneralSystemException
- 汎用システム例外SAPFinancialAppException
- 会計業務アプリケーション例外SAPFinancialSystemException
- 会計業務システム例外public void setTblParam(java.lang.String paramTable, java.lang.String paramName, java.lang.String value, int index) throws SAPFinancialSystemException
paramTable
- テーブル名paramName
- 項目名value
- セットする値index
- レコード番号SAPFinancialSystemException
- 会計業務システム例外public void setProjectDefinition(java.lang.String strProjectDefinition)
strProjectDefinition
- プロジェクト定義を識別するキーpublic void setWithActivities(java.lang.String strWithActivities)
strWithActivities
- 従属活動がエクスポートされますpublic void setWithMilestones(java.lang.String strWithMilestones)
strWithMilestones
- 従属 WBS マイルストーンがエクスポートされますpublic void setWithSubtree(java.lang.String strWithSubtree)
strWithSubtree
- サブプロジェクトがエクスポートされますpublic java.lang.String getProjectDefinition() throws SAPFinancialSystemException
SAPFinancialSystemException
- 会計業務システム例外public java.lang.String getWithActivities() throws SAPFinancialSystemException
SAPFinancialSystemException
- 会計業務システム例外public java.lang.String getWithMilestones() throws SAPFinancialSystemException
SAPFinancialSystemException
- 会計業務システム例外public java.lang.String getWithSubtree() throws SAPFinancialSystemException
SAPFinancialSystemException
- 会計業務システム例外public void setProjectDefinition(ProjectDefinition projectDefinition)
projectDefinition
- プロジェクトについての詳細情報public void setImpWbsElementList(java.util.List<ImpWbsElement> impWbsElementList)
impWbsElementList
- 詳細情報を必要とする WBS 要素public void setExpWbsElementList(java.util.List<ExpWbsElement> expWbsElementList)
expWbsElementList
- WBS 要素についての詳細情報public void setExpWbsMilestoneList(java.util.List<ExpWbsMilestone> expWbsMilestoneList)
expWbsMilestoneList
- WBS マイルストーンに関する詳細情報public void setExpWbsHierarchieList(java.util.List<ExpWbsHierarchie> expWbsHierarchieList)
expWbsHierarchieList
- WBS 階層についての情報public void setExpActivityList(java.util.List<ExpActivity> expActivityList)
expActivityList
- 活動に関する詳細情報public void setExpMessageList(java.util.List<ExpMessage> expMessageList)
expMessageList
- 詳細情報を読み込みエラーpublic ProjectDefinition getProjectDefinitionInfo()
public java.util.List<ImpWbsElement> getImpWbsElementList()
public java.util.List<ExpWbsElement> getExpWbsElementList()
public java.util.List<ExpWbsMilestone> getExpWbsMilestoneList()
public java.util.List<ExpWbsHierarchie> getExpWbsHierarchieList()
public java.util.List<ExpActivity> getExpActivityList()
public java.util.List<ExpMessage> getExpMessageList()
Copyright (c) 2013 NTT DATA INTRAMART CORPORATION.